無線網絡與有線網絡的很大的不同是信号分布的到處都是,是以很容易被監聽,這樣網絡中資料安全的傳輸就成為了很大的問題,于是人們發明了各種方法來保證資料的正确的傳輸,這個就是所謂的Wireless Lan Security.
無線區域網路中,連接配接AP,必須要認證(authentication) ,目前主要的的Sceurity技術如下:
There are several security technologies introduced to
solve the authentication problem and to preserve the
privacy and integrity of data transmitted on air.
IEEE802.11 specified three basic security technologies
to authenticate access to the WLAN and to preserve the
privacy of data transmitted, they are open system
authentication, shared key authentication and WEP [1] .
Because of the shortcoming of security technologies in
IEEE802.11, Wi-Fi Alliance released a new security
standard for the industry called "Wi-Fi Protected
Access" (WPA) [8] . WPA added two more technologies,
namely, IEEE802.1x to improve authentication and
TKIP for privacy and integrity of information. Recently
IEEE published a new security standard for WLANs, the
new standard is IEEE802.11i [22] , the new standard
provides enhancements of the security shortcomings of
WEP and it comprises all security technologies in WPA.
In addition to that, IEEE802.11i adopts recently certified
encryption algorithm called the "Advanced Encryption
Standard" (AES).
